|
群服务器负载均衡CSLB(Cluster
Server Load Balance)是由辽宁般若网络科技有限公司完全独立自主开发的集群服务器负载均衡软件,是一个用纯软件实现的负载均衡,不需要什么特别的设备。
随着网络应用的普及和发展,特别是Internet的大规模应用,越来越多的应用面临多用户、高并发的服务器应用要求。功能强大的多CPU
PC服务器、小型机甚至是更强大的大型机,当然可以满足这样的应用需求,但价格也非常昂贵。而用多台价格较低廉的服务器组成的机群Cluster
Server,同样可以满足多用户、高并发服务器应用的需求。并且与使用单台高性能服务器主机比较,CSLB还具有以下一些优点: |
| |
| 1、高性能价格比 |
| |
虽然多CPU的高性能主机服务器(包括小型机、大型机和PC
SERVER)具有处理多用户高并发访问的能力,但价格昂贵,而且多CPU共用1台物理设备的内存等资源,在多任务处理上还不如Cluster
Server。因为,在Cluster Server中,每台服务器都具有独立内存和硬盘等资源,物理上是独立的设备,处理并发的每个任务,都是相对独立地进行。例如,1台8个CPU的服务器价格要在30万RMB以上,而8台高速单CPU的服务器,价格不会超过10万RMB。
因此,不仅仅是"性能价格比",可以说,无论是性能上还是价格上,采用Cluster Server都胜过多CPU的高性能主机服务器。 |
| |
| 2、高可靠性 |
| |
多CPU高性能服务器主机,毕竟是单一的物理设备,一旦出现故障,可不是坏1个CPU的问题,整个系统将会瘫痪。而Cluster
Server是多台独立的服务器,任何1台服务器出现故障,系统都不会瘫痪,会在最多不超过200毫秒(也就是1/5秒)内自动将任务分配给无故障的服务器,系统照样运行。 |
| |
| 3、高可扩展性 |
| |
对于无论是高性能PC
SERVER、小型机还是大型主机,要扩展内存、增加CPU数量都不是一件简单的事情,无论如何都需要停机进行扩展。而Clusetr
Server则不需要,可以随时增加服务器数量来提高Cluster的整体性能。 |
| |
| 4、简单易用 |
| |
CSLB安装与设置非常简单,不需要在被容错服务器上安装任何东西,也不需要在被容错服务器串口间连接"心跳线",只在1台计算机上进行安装CSLB软件,设置上Cluster中的服务器IP地址就可以了。 |
| |
| 5、高度兼容 |
| |
CSLB是一个基于标准TCP/IP协议的软件,对于后面被均衡的数据库服务器、服务器硬件、操作系统Windows,Linux,Unix,AIX,Solaris等,对
Web Server 也没有限制。 |
| |
| 6、安全性 |
|
|
CSLB采用双网卡对应用服务器系统进行容错,可以将两块网卡设置在不同的IP网段上,"隔断"用户与服务器之间的网络连接,CSLB只允许TCP协议数据通过,服务器只能接收到TCP某些具体应用的连接,可以起到"防火墙"的网络物理隔断作用。 |